Transaction c6c14360666bfbedea90bf8f4f3859262addf81420fd2dfa234e4fef6c73eabb
1 Input
1 Output
-
c6c14360666bfbedea90bf8f4f3859262addf81420fd2dfa234e4fef6c73eabb:0
- value
- 17985300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c2ecd7428880aeb040d9c44644ff236477b472f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CKcrgkj3pV7bCsvvWZeMM4CqGjvZScXcC